What MSIL/Kryptik.CFE virus can do?

  • Executable code extraction
  • Creates RWX memory
  • Reads data out of its own binary image
  • Drops a binary and executes it
  • The binary likely contains encrypted or compressed data.
  • Uses Windows utilities for basic functionality
  • Sniffs keystrokes
  • Installs itself for autorun at Windows startup
  • Creates a hidden or system file
